Output bf7ac265dcbde0533671d8164a42e793314d7af87b4571423480cd0cd14dad1d:3

value
577054
script pubkey
OP_0 OP_PUSHBYTES_20 8e39e6a31c9007a6cd7fc9a93de42500771a6546
address
bc1q3cu7dgcujqr6dntlex5nmep9qpm35e2x6mqvrs
transaction
bf7ac265dcbde0533671d8164a42e793314d7af87b4571423480cd0cd14dad1d
spent
true